WebFeb 15, 2011 · The diagnosis of ocular toxoplasmosis is made mainly by clinical observation of a focal necrotizing retinochoroiditis. 15 In atypical cases, serologic tests such as serum anti-Toxoplasma titers of IgM and IgG may be helpful to support the diagnosis. Negative results are of importance to exclude atypical ocular toxoplasmosis. WebPlatelia™ Toxo IgG is a test for detection and titration of IgG antibodies to Toxoplasma gondii in human serum or plasma using an indirect ELISA immuno-enzymatic method. T. gondii antigen is used for coating the microplate. A monoclonal antibody labeled with peroxydase which is specific for human gamma chains (anti-IgG) is used as the conjugate. WebIf the IgG titers for toxoplasmosis are completely negative, down to a 1:1 dilution, then toxoplasmosis is completely ruled out in an immunocompetent person. It is possible that an immunosuppressed patient could have a completely negative immunoglobulin titers and have active ocular toxoplasmosis infection.
